INUTX vs. SMGIX - Performance Comparison

The chart below illustrates the hypothetical performance of a $10,000 investment in Columbia Dividend Opportunity Fund (INUTX) and Columbia Contrarian Core Fund (SMGIX). The values are adjusted to include any dividend payments, if applicable.

Loading charts...

Returns By Period

In the year-to-date period, INUTX achieves a 16.94% return, which is significantly higher than SMGIX's 11.44% return. Over the past 10 years, INUTX has underperformed SMGIX with an annualized return of 10.56%, while SMGIX has yielded a comparatively higher 14.47% annualized return.

Correlation

The correlation between INUTX and SMGIX is 0.49, which is low. Their historical price movements had little consistent relationship.

The rank (0–100) uses a weighted average of the Sharpe, Sortino, Omega, Calmar, and Martin percentile ranks for the trailing 12 months. Higher means stronger historical risk-adjusted performance within the peer group.
